UDF > GUI > GuiTab >


_GUICtrlTab_SetItemSize

Définit la largeur et la hauteur des onglets dans un contrôle avec largeur fixe ou dessiné par son propriétaire

#include <GuiTab.au3>
_GUICtrlTab_SetItemSize ( $hWnd, $iWidth, $iHeight )

Paramètres

$hWnd ID/handle du contrôle Tab
$iWidth Nouvelle largeur, en pixels, de tous les onglets
$iHeight Nouvelle hauteur, en pixels, de tous les onglets

Valeur de retour

Retourne la largeur et la hauteur précedemment définies.
    La largeur est dans le mot de poids faible de la valeur de retour, et la hauteur est le mot de poids fort.

Exemple

#include <GUIConstantsEx.au3>
#include <GuiTab.au3>

Example()

Func Example()
    Local $idTab

    ; Crée une GUI
    GUICreate("Tab Control Set Item Size", 400, 300)
    $idTab = GUICtrlCreateTab(2, 2, 396, 296, BitOR($TCS_BUTTONS, $TCS_FIXEDWIDTH))
    _GUICtrlTab_SetItemSize($idTab, 70, 40)
    GUISetState(@SW_SHOW)

    ; Ajoute des onglets
    _GUICtrlTab_InsertItem($idTab, 0, "Tab 1")
    _GUICtrlTab_InsertItem($idTab, 1, "Tab 2")
    _GUICtrlTab_InsertItem($idTab, 2, "Tab 3")

    ; Boucle jusqu'à ce que l'utilisateur quitte.
    Do
    Until GUIGetMsg() = $GUI_EVENT_CLOSE
    GUIDelete()
EndFunc   ;==>Example